Class KeywordingFieldAdapter

  • Direct Known Subclasses:
    EditableFieldAdapter

    public class KeywordingFieldAdapter
    extends Object

    Überschrift: KeywordingFieldAdapter

    Beschreibung: Kapselt ein Feld der Verschlagwortung (z.B. im IndexDialog) gegenüber dem Script.

    Copyright: Copyright (c) ELO Digital Office GmbH 2012-2014

    • Constructor Summary

      Constructors 
      Constructor Description
      KeywordingFieldAdapter​(EloScript scripting, IndexFieldFactory fieldFactory, FieldManager fieldManager, IndexTabsFactory tabs, String fieldID)
      Interner Konstruktor.
    • Method Summary

      Modifier and Type Method Description
      Label getLabel()
      Liefert den Titel (Label) des Felds.
      String getValue()
      Liefert den Wert des Felds.
      void setLabelVisible​(boolean visible)
      Setzt die Sichtbarkeit des Labels (für den Namen des Indexfelds).
      void setVisible​(boolean visible)
      Setzt die Sichtbarkeit des Indexfelds.
      • Methods inherited from class Object

        equ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• KeywordingFieldAdapter

        public KeywordingFieldAdapter​(EloScript scripting,
                                      IndexFieldFactory fieldFactory,
                                      FieldManager fieldManager,
                                      IndexTabsFactory tabs,
                                      String fieldID)
        Interner Konstruktor.
        Parameters:
        scripting - Scripting des Client
        fieldFactory - Feld-Factory
        fieldManager - Feld-Manager
        tabs - Tab-Factory
        fieldID - Feld-Id
    • Method Detail

      • getValue

        public String getValue()
        Liefert den Wert des Felds.
        Returns:
        Wert des Felds.
        Since:
        7.00.010
      • setVisible

        public void setVisible​(boolean visible)
        Setzt die Sichtbarkeit des Indexfelds.
        Parameters:
        visible - True für ein sichtbares Feld, False für ein unsichtbares Feld.
        Since:
        7.00.010
      • setLabelVisible

        public void setLabelVisible​(boolean visible)
        Setzt die Sichtbarkeit des Labels (für den Namen des Indexfelds).
        Parameters:
        visible - True für ein sichtbares Label, False für ein unsichtbares Label.
        Since:
        8.00.008
      • getLabel

        public Label getLabel()
        Liefert den Titel (Label) des Felds.
        Returns:
        Titel-Label
        Since:
        8.04.000